Excerpt from Adelaide and Theodore, or Letters on Education, Vol. 1: Containing All the Principles Relative to Three Different Plans of Education; To That of Princes, and to Those of Young Persons of Both Sexes It is from them I except the happiness of my future life, and I dedicate myself entirely to their education. I shall perhaps appear to the world to make a great and painful sacrifice: I shall also be accused of singularly and caprice, and indeed with reason. I cannot in this letter lay open to you all my ideas. They are too numerous and extensive. When I arrive at B -, I shall write you all the particulars, which you have a right to except from my confidence and friendship. Be assured, my dear Viscount, that I shall not lose sight of the delightful project we have formed, and which ought to draw still closer the bonds which unite us. Removing my son in his infancy from the examples of vice, in becoming his governor and his friend, am I not working for you as well as for myself? Since it is virtue alone can render him worthy the happiness you design for him. Farewell, dear Viscount: let me hear from you; be not too hasty in judging me, and above all do not condemn me, before you know all the motives which may influence my conduct. My wife is writing to yours a long letter: but knowing so well the Viscountess, she fears her vivacity, and entreats you to moderate its effect as much as possible. Excerpt from Adelaide and Theodore, or Letters on Education, Vol. 3: Containing All the Principles Relative to Three Different Plans of Education; To That of Princes, and to Those of Young Persons of Both Sexes Oh! Mamma, let us keep her! She is so pretty, and looks so mild! - That is impossible! - But at least keep her here for some days - Well, I consent to that; and you, Adelaide, shall have the care of her; I have so many other employments... With all my heart... Mamma, she shall sleep in my chamber... Oh! the charming little creature! I will be her Governess!... I must talk to her in Italian. In short, as all this discourse had passed in French, the child did not understand one word of it. - Adelaide, embracing her tenderly, said, I am going to be your Mamma. - Shall I? At the word Mamma, the poor little thing wept bitterly, and cried, I have none! Adelaide fell on her neck, and, taking her in her arms, my Mamma will be yours, she said - The child then looked at me, her eyes still full of tears; is it true, said she, that I shall remain with you always?... She asked this question with so much simplicity, so tender an air, and sweet a tone of voice, that I felt it to the bottom of my heart - Yes, replied I, you shall never leave us. - These words made Adelaide as happy as the child, and more so, when I added, that I was really determined to keep her, because she appeared to be as sensible as she was pretty. - But, Mamma! said Adelaide, you have promised also, that I shall be her Governess - We shall see that, answered I, we will talk about it in the evening. - At half past eight, when the child was gone to bed, I had a long conversation on the subject with Adelaide.
